Default Help with part description/number

Trying to figure out what the little rubber shields are that are attached to riveted strips in the engine bay of my 69 S2 coupe are called and if possible the part number.

They are riveted to the cross member just in front of the heater box unit. In the photo you can see the rubber just to left and right of the heater fan unit. They are meant to seal that area from tire splash. thank you!

That's a "Mud Shield Rubber" I believe part number BD20434. As I recall Moss sells you a roll of it and you cut the lengths to fit, including punching holes for the rivets. If you have them, best to save the old ones to use as templates.
